What is CVE-2023-3471?

A buffer overflow vulnerability exists in Panasonic KW Watcher versions 1.00 through 2.82. This flaw could enable attackers to execute arbitrary code by exploiting the improper handling of memory buffers. Users of the affected versions should take immediate action to mitigate potential risks associated with this vulnerability.
